Audrina Patridge is taking the challenges of new motherhood in stride.
The former reality star, 31, welcomed her daughter Kirra Max with fiancé Corey Bohan in June, and she’s still getting used to post-pregnancy life — namely, breastfeeding.
But on Monday, Patridge’s sister Casey Patridge Loza managed to snap a sweet moment of the new mom nursing her baby girl.
“@caseyloza always capturing me in moments #momonthego,” she wrote, referring to her sister, who originally shared the photo of Patridge breastfeeding.

Patridge talked to PEOPLE exclusively about these special — not to mention, difficult — moments as a new mom.
“Breastfeeding was the most painful thing,” she said of nursing her 13-week-old little girl. “For me, it was more painful than the c-section!”
The lifestyle blogger said it took a while to look as serene as she did in the Instagram photo.
“The first two to three weeks were excruciating,” she said. “But I got through it!”

And she had a great helper by her side. “I slept on the couch for a week,” she said. “My grandma came and helped for a week. It was crazy!”
Despite the sleepless nights, Patridge said nothing beats her new role.
“Once I had Kirra, nothing else mattered,” Patridge said of her daughter, who is now sleeping six to seven hours a night. “I didn’t care about the dishes piling up or anything. I just let it go.”
